A quick search for “Japanese steel hair scissors” will return countless examples of boxes branded “Japanese” that never set foot in Japan. Independent scissor-industry writers have addressed this phenomenon directly, noting that “‘Japanese’ on a scissor box can legally mean anything from ‘forged in Seki by a master smith’ to ‘designed in California, made in a factory in Pakistan, with a Japanese-sounding model name.’ There’s no protected definition.” Indeed, one Reddit thread compiling common scissor sales tactics lists “‘Japanese Steel’ means Made in Japan” as the number one myth to dispel. This is precisely the ambiguity that MATSUOPRO aims to avoid with the China 440C series.

440C is a martensitic stainless steel characterized by its 16-18% chromium content, lending it adequate Corrosion Resistance performance in typical salon settings; it still requires routine cleaning and pivot oiling just like any professional steel shear.
At average professional usage levels (20-25 clients/week), scissors of 440C grade generally need resharpening approximately every three to four months, as opposed to every two to three months for higher hardness VG10/ATS-314 steels, because softer steels experience a higher degree of wear during each sharpening pass.
China 440C in this line uses the same core alloy composition (ASTM A276) as the premium Japanese 440C range, with a different sourcing and tempering target: Our Japanese 440C is typically tempered to HRC 57-59 on Japan-sourced plate steel, whereas this line is tempered to HRC 56-58 to provide a more budget-friendly option. Both are genuinely produced steels; the disparity in hardness levels is explicitly communicated rather than blurred.

This is genuine professional-grade steel, with the caveat that volume matter. If you’re operating at or above 20-40 clients per week and plan on using shears for many years, higher hardness steels are cost-effective due to the reduced sharpening frequency and extended blade life. For apprentices, moderate stylists, or private label trial runs, 440C represents an excellent entry point rather than a compromise.
